Sie suchen Ihre bereits erworbenen Lerninhalte? Dann geht es hier entlang: Zum academy Campus

heise Academy Logo
Classrooms

GitHub Copilot, OpenAI & Co. – KI-Werkzeuge für produktives Coding

KI revolutioniert die Softwareentwicklung. Unser Experte analysiert die Marktführer GitHub Copilot und OpenAI und stellt ihnen aktuelle Herausforderer gegenüber, etwa Cursor AI, V0 und Anthropic. Teilnehmende lernen praxisnah, wie diese Werkzeuge im Hintergrund funktionieren, wie man sie produktiv einsetzt, welches Potenzial sie haben und wo ihre Grenzen liegen.

Im Professional und Enterprise Pass enthalten

Lernen von den besten IT-Experten: Interaktiv und live mit academy Classrooms

Mehr Infos & Kauf
Sie haben bereits einen academy Pass?
Enterprise
Professional

GitHub Copilot, OpenAI & Co. – KI-Werkzeuge für produktives Coding

Dieser Classroom hat bereits stattgefunden. Die Aufzeichnung steht Nutzer des Professional Pass und Enterprise Pass im Campus zur Verfügung: Zum academy Campus

Überblick

Als Einführung in die Welt des AI-gestützten Codings liefert unser Experte Rainer Stropek einen umfassenden Überblick zu den Marktführern GitHub Copilot und OpenAI sowie aktuellen Herausforderern, etwa Cursor AI und Anthropic. Dabei zeigt er die Möglichkeiten dieser Technologien auf, die den Entwicklungsalltag immer stärker beeinflussen.

In der ersten Session stehen die Grundlagen verschiedener KI-Assistenten im Fokus. Sie erfahren, welche Unterstützungsfunktionen diese Tools bieten und wie Sie damit Ihre Produktivität steigern. Das zweite Webinar widmet sich weiterführenden Einsatzszenarien, etwa der automatischen Generierung von Tests, Fehlerbehebung und Dokumentation. Ein Vergleich der vorgestellten Tools ermöglicht es Ihnen, die für Ihre Anforderungen optimale Lösung zu finden.

Im dritten Termin werfen wir einen Blick hinter die Kulissen und beleuchten die technischen Grundlagen der KI-Assistenten. Sie lernen die verwendeten Prompting-Strategien, APIs und Kommunikationswege kennen. Die vierte Session legt den Schwerpunkt auf die Web-APIs von OpenAI und Anthropic und betrachtet diese im Detail. Zum Abschluss des Classrooms erfahren Sie, wie Sie mithilfe von Embeddings und dem RAG-Entwurfsmuster leistungsstarke KI-Funktionen in Ihre eigenen Projekte implementieren.

In diesem Classroom analysieren wir die aktuellen Trends in der AI-gestützten Softwareentwicklung und vermitteln, wie man die richtigen Tools auswählt, um die eigenen Arbeitsabläufe zu optimieren. Neben praktischen Live-Demos gibt es auch tiefe Einblicke in die Funktionsweise dieser Werkzeuge und eine Diskussion über langfristige Auswirkungen des zunehmenden Einsatzes von AI in der Entwicklung. Die Sessions sind darauf ausgelegt, sowohl praktische Anwendung als auch strategische Überlegungen zu kombinieren, um die Effizienz und Qualität in der Softwareentwicklung zu steigern.

Zielgruppe

Dieser Classroom richtet sich an erfahrene Entwicklerinnen und Entwickler, die neugierig darauf sind, wie AI-basierte Coding Assistants in der Praxis ihre Produktivität steigern können. Sie lernen die verschiedenen Tools kennen und erfahren, wie diese Werkzeuge im Hintergrund funktionieren (z.B. welche LLMs, APIs und Anwendungsmuster sie verwenden). Der Classroom ist das richtige für Personen, die viele Praxisbeispiele statt PowerPoint-Slides sehen möchten.

Voraussetzungen

Der Fokus liegt auf TypeScript als gemeinsamer Basis für die Demonstrationen, jedoch sind die Konzepte auf eine Vielzahl von Programmiersprachen übertragbar. Eine Vertrautheit mit den Grundlagen von TypeScript wird empfohlen. Basiskenntnisse über die Entwicklung verteilter Systeme, insbesondere mit Web APIs, werden vorausgesetzt. Praxiserfahrung im Umgang mit AI-Systemen wie ChatGPT (Prompting) ist von Vorteil, jedoch keine Voraussetzung.

Für Teilnehmende, die tiefer in die Materie eintauchen möchten, besteht im Verlauf des Classrooms die Möglichkeit, die vorgestellten Beispiele aktiv mitzuverfolgen. Dazu benötigen sie lediglich gültige API-Keys für die OpenAI- und Anthropic-Plattformen.

Agenda

  • Überblick über Funktionsweise von AI Coding Assistants (GitHub Copilot, OpenAI Canvas, Cursor AI, V0 sowie weitere, aktuelle Tools)

  • Überblick über wichtige LLMs im Bereich Coding (OpenAI GPT-Modelle, Anthropic Claude, Tool-spezifische LLMs; Fokus auf SaaS-Angeboten)

  • Vergleich verschiedener AI-gestützter Entwicklungstools speziell im Umfeld von Visual Studio Code (JetBrains-Tools werden nicht behandelt)

  • Tipps und Tricks zur Verwendung von AI Assistants beim Coding

  • Einblicke in die Funktionsweise und Hintergründe von KI-Coding-Assistenten

  • Einführung in Web APIs von LLMs am Beispiel von OpenAI und Anthropic (Codebeispiele in TypeScript)

  • Erklärung der Funktionsweise von RAG (Retrieval Augmented Generation) und ihrer Anwendung in Coding Assistants

Foto von Rainer Stropek

Rainer Stropek

CEO, passionierter Entwickler, Trainer, Speaker, CoderDojo Mentor | software architetcs

Zum Profil

GitHub Copilot, OpenAI & Co. – KI-Werkzeuge für produktives Coding

Dieser Classroom hat bereits stattgefunden. Die Aufzeichnung steht Nutzer des Professional Pass und Enterprise Pass im Campus zur Verfügung: Zum academy Campus

Haben Sie Fragen zu unseren academy Classrooms? Wir helfen Ihnen gern weiter.

Füllen Sie ganz einfach und bequem das Kontaktformular aus und wir werden Ihnen Ihre Fragen schnellstmöglich beantworten.

Profilbild von Team Events

Team Events

events@heise-academy.de

+49 511 5352 8603

Telefonisch erreichbar: Mo – Fr | 9 – 17 Uhr

Unsere Antworten auf die häufigsten Fragen

Kontaktformular

Bei Betätigen des Absenden-Buttons verarbeiten wir die von Ihnen angegebenen personenbezogenen Daten ausschließlich für den Zweck Ihrer Anfrage. Weitere Informationen zum Datenschutz finden Sie in unserer Datenschutzerklärung.